There were probably some CS units which wore them with yellow trim but look at original pictures to see what was really being worn. The thing about a yellow trimmed kepi was that it usually would have to be bought from a supplier and not issued from a depot. The number of original kepis or "caps" that survived is very few. All enlisted kepis I have seen are very plain. Officers caps tend to be better quality and may be adorned with rank piping or colored trim. The exception (and there always are exceptions) would be a unit which was well supplied from other sources other than a government depot. An example of this would have been the Washington Artillery from New Orleans with their red trimmed kepis. Don't know what the Yanks were wearing but I suspect there are more Yellow trimmed kepis on Sutler row than were in either army.
